Law firm representing alleged Epstein victims sends scathing letter over DOJ document release​


“… According to the attorneys' filing, the House Oversight release included the unredacted names and personal information of dozens of victims, including women who were minors at the time of their abuse. One document alone contained 28 unredacted names of alleged victim, the attorneys wrote.

Based on the scope of the issue, the attorneys said that they believe the DOJ either "does not know the identities of all the victims of Jeffrey Epstein and thus cannot apply proper redactions to the files," or "is intentionally failing to protect victims from public exposure."

"While we will detail the various excuses that the Court will no doubt be provided, this is absolutely unacceptable and a program that must be rectified prior to the public release of any additional documents," the Edwards Henderson attorneys wrote.

The filing further noted that the DOJ publicly acknowledged in July that "Epstein harmed over one thousand victims." Based on that statement, the attorneys asked in the filing that the court confirm with the DOJ that, prior to submitting the files to the House Oversight Committee, "it undertook the onerous and necessary task of redacting all one thousand plus victim names that it had in its possession."

"On that pointed inquiry, the court will learn the DOJ's redaction process and its process efforts are so irreconcilable with the number of victims it has publicly acknowledged that, when confronted with the discrepancy, its response will land somewhere between incoherent mumbling, non sequitur, and outright misrepresentation," the attorneys wrote.…”
